Overview
Ferry County is a scenic rural region in northeastern Washington state, defined by mountains, forest, lakes, and a pioneering spirit. Visitors come for outdoor activities, small-town charm, and glimpses of gold rush history.
Best Time to Visit
June-September for warm, dry weather and open hiking trails
Local Tips
Cell service can be spotty; download maps beforehand. Locally owned restaurants are the best spots for food, expect early closing times.
Cultural Etiquette
Tipping (15-20%) is standard in restaurants. Dress is casual, but pack outdoor gear. Respect private property and native lands.
Safety Warnings
Wildlife sightings are common, secure food and hike with caution. Some roads are unpaved; drive carefully. Avoid trespassing on reservation lands without permission.
Hidden Gems
Visit the Stonerose Fossil Site for fossil digging; take the Rail Trail for secluded biking; try fishing at Curlew Lake; explore the Republic Brewing Company for local flavors.
